      Terex AC80-2 vs. Liebherr LTM1500-8.1 (84M)

      6 reasons to buy Terex AC80-2:

      Sizes

      Upperstructure rear swing radius 3700 mm and 6015 mm 38 % less or 2315 mm

      Gear box

      Maximum forward speed 80 km/h and 75 km/h 6 % more or 5 km/h
      Maximum reverse gear 11 km/h and 7.2 km/h 35 % more or 3.8 km/h

      Booms

      Minimum operating radius 3 m and 5 m 40 % less or 2 m
      Minimum height at maximum lifting angle 12.8 m and 16.1 m 20 % less or 3.3 m
      Rotation speed 1.3 rev / min and 1 rev / min 23 % more or 0.3 rev

      8 reasons to buy Liebherr LTM1500-8.1 (84M):

      Operation

      Axels number 8 and 4 50 % more or 4
      Haul truck fuel volume 600 l. and 400 l. 33 % more or 200 l.

      Carrying part engine

      Maximum torque 4067.5 Nm and 2000 Nm 51 % more or 2067.5 Nm

      Booms

      Max. height at max. lifting angle without boom 84 m and 53.7 m 36 % more or 30.3 m
      Maximum angle of ascent 83 degrees and 81.5 degrees 2 % more or 1.5 degrees
      Maximum lifting capacity 500000 kg and 80000 kg 84 % more or 420000 kg
      Sections number 7 and 5 29 % more or 2
      Maximum working radius 78 m and 42 m 46 % more or 36 m

      Neutral reasons:

      Sizes

      Transport length 12110 mm and 20970 mm
      Transport width 2750 mm and 6250 mm
      Transport height 3800 mm and 3950 mm
      Hauler length 9970 mm and 18630 mm

      Operation

      Operating voltage 24 V and 24 V
      Tyre size 14.00R25 and 14R25

      Gear box

      Transmission type Allison automatic transmission and automatic with torque converter ZF TC-tronic

      Carrying part engine

      Manufacturer Daimler Chrysler and Liebherr
      Model OM 501 LA and D9508 A7
